top of page

Implementing Machine Learning for Enhanced Data Insights in Organizations

Businesses can unlock unprecedented analytical capabilities by strategically identifying and integrating diverse data sources, selecting the most effective algorithms, meticulously preparing data, and building scalable machine learning pipelines. Furthermore, evaluating and enhancing ML-driven decision-making ensures that insights remain accurate and actionable.


Identifying and Integrating Relevant Data Sources


Experts at C&F say that unlocking machine learning's full potential starts with strategically identifying and integrating diverse data sources. Organizations must meticulously evaluate internal and external data repositories to pinpoint the most valuable inputs for their machine-learning projects. Internal data sources often include CRM systems, ERP platforms, and IoT devices, each providing unique data types that can enhance predictive analytics and operational efficiency.


On the other hand, external data sources such as social media platforms, public datasets, and third-party APIs offer supplementary contextual information that can significantly enrich data insights. For example, a healthcare provider might integrate patient records from internal systems with social media sentiment to better understand public health trends. According to industry experts, balancing the volume, velocity, and variety of data — the so-called three Vs of big data — is crucial for building robust machine learning models that deliver actionable insights.


To effectively integrate these data sources, organizations should adopt comprehensive data integration frameworks that ensure seamless data flow and consistency across various platforms. Leveraging tools that facilitate data cleaning, transformation, and storage can streamline the integration process, making harnessing the full spectrum of available data easier. By prioritizing the right data sources and employing best practices in data integration, businesses can lay a solid foundation for their machine learning initiatives, driving enhanced data-driven decision-making and gaining a competitive edge in their respective industries.


Choosing the Appropriate Machine Learning Algorithms


Picking the correct machine learning algorithm is a game-changer for any organization aiming to harness data insights. It's not just about cool tech; it's about aligning your choices with business objectives to drive actual results. Here's a streamlined approach to make sure you're not shooting in the dark:

  1. Regression: Best for predicting continuous outcomes like sales figures or market trends and, for example, using linear regression to forecast next quarter's revenue based on past performance.

  2. Classification: Perfect for sorting data into categories, such as identifying fraudulent transactions or classifying customer feedback as positive or negative.

  3. Clustering is ideal for uncovering hidden patterns or groupings within your data, like segmenting customers based on purchasing behavior without predefined labels.

Don't forget the importance of model evaluation metrics in this process. Metrics like accuracy, precision, and recall are essential to ensuring your chosen algorithm fits your data and delivers reliable and actionable insights.


Data Preparation and Feature Engineering Strategies


Achieving high-quality data begins with careful data preparation. First, clean your dataset to eliminate inconsistencies and errors, ensuring your machine learning models receive reliable inputs. Next, apply normalization techniques to scale your data, which helps improve the accuracy and efficiency of your algorithms. Addressing missing values is crucial; strategies like imputation or removal can significantly affect your model's performance.


Once your data is well-prepared, feature engineering becomes essential for enhancing model insights. Transforming raw data into meaningful features can reveal deeper patterns and relationships within your dataset. For example, creating interaction terms or aggregating data points can enhance your models' predictive power. Visual aids, such as before-and-after charts, can effectively illustrate the impact of these transformations, making it easier to understand how feature engineering increases the value of your data.


Implementing Scalable Machine Learning Pipelines


Setting up scalable machine learning pipelines isn't just a tech buzzword—it's the backbone of turning data into actionable insights. Kick things off with solid data ingestion; think real-time streams or batch uploads that keep your pipeline fed without choking. Next up, data processing has to handle the load, whether you're using Apache Spark, Kafka, or something else that keeps things running smoothly as data flows in.


When it's time for model training, leverage frameworks like TensorFlow or PyTorch that don't just play nice but scale with your needs. Deploying these models? Tools like Kubernetes and Docker are your best friends, making sure your models move from the lab to the real world without a hitch.


Evaluating and Enhancing ML-Driven Decision Making


Make sure your machine learning initiatives are noticed. To truly leverage ML for superior decision-making, organizations need to assess their insights' impact systematically. Start by identifying the key performance indicators (KPIs) that matter most to your business.


  1. Accuracy – Determines how often your ML predictions are correct.

  2. Precision – Measures the relevancy of the positive results generated by your models.

  3. Business-Specific Metrics – Custom indicators tailored to your organization's unique objectives.


Gathering and analyzing feedback is crucial for continuously improving your ML models.

Implementing dashboards and visualization tools can help present evaluation results clearly and promptly. This approach highlights areas for enhancement and ensures that your ML-driven decisions remain aligned with your strategic goals.


  • LinkedIn
  • Facebook
  • Instagram
  • Spotify

CURRENT ISSUE

Sariki.jpg
bottom of page